(10 points) Many operations can be performed faster on sorted data than on unsorted data. For each of the following operations, state whether it could be performed faster if the data values were sorted (do not take the cost of the sorting into account). Please give a brief explanation. Assume an array is used to store data. (a) Find the median value. (b) Calculate the sum of all data in the array. (c) Partition the array according to a given pivot value. (d) Insert a new value to the middle position (which is empty) of the array.
